There are two kinds of connections among controller, server and client: one is that DCs controller has Ethernet interface, and the three are connected by Ethernet switch. The switch has a variety of ports, and the data transmission rate of each port can be different. The number of ports is determined by the number of computers connected. The main indicators of the switch are the backplane width and memory size. If Ethernet cables such as 10base and 100base are used, the rate can be transmitted. If category 5 cable is used, it can only be 10base. In Figure 2, the Ethernet connection is star shaped. Use discrete
Cables connect each computer to a central connection point, commonly referred to as a network hub. Each computer uses an independent cable. The connection failure only affects the relevant single computer, and other computers can continue to run. If each machine has the same adapter rate, the Ethernet star connection usually uses a 10baset cable.
